Re: No documentation on the "Paravirtualization Interface"op

Post by Technologov »

VirtualBox added some host-side features of KVM and Hyper V (for Linux guests and Windows guests, respectively). Note this only covers clocks/timers, for better precision time in virtual machines.

This is not full-scale PV. (no VirtIO-block device hard disk for example), but nice thing.
